Daily: Crude oil prices continue the 2-week decline amid refined oil glut lingering concerns

Crude oil prices continued to decline on Monday amid lingering concerns over a global supply glut and weakening demand dragging prices to their lowest settlement in roughly two months. Oil was also under pressure after Goldman Sachs said in a research report that oil prices could go "sharply lower" as storage tanks hit capacity, predicting the oil market would not balance itself in 2016. Brent crude fell 45 cents, or almost 1 percent, to settle at $47.54 a barrel. U.S. crude eased 62 cents, or 1.4 percent, to end at $43.98. Both crude benchmarks have declined by 10 percent over the past two weeks.

Ukraine accumulates 15.8 bcm of gas in reserves

Ukraine has collected 15.8 billion cubic metres (bcm) of gas in underground storage as of Monday, ten days before the heating season, as stated by gas transport monopoly Ukrtransgaz.

BASF finalizes asset switch with Gazprom

BASF has exchanged assets with Gazprom which will give the German firm access to Western Siberia projects while the Russian company will obtain gas storage facility in Europe.

Daily: Crude oil prices down 3% amid tumbling equities on Wall Street

Crude oil prices lost nearly by 3 percent on Monday, dragged down by declining equities on Wall Street and pessimistic economic data, even if an expected drawdown in crude inventories at the main U.S. storage hub was likely to curb losses. WTI crude fell 2.8 percent to settle at $44.43 a barrel. Brent crude futures shed $1.18, or 2.5 percent to close $48 a barrel.

Germany: RWE’s power-to-gas plant opens

RWE’s power-to-gas plant has officially been opened in Ibbenbüren, Germany. It is an energy storage technology which connects the supply of local power, natural gas and district heating.
